Alaska beer makes Minnesota foray

After announcing in March that their beers would be making their first regular appearances east of the Rocky Mountains, Alaska Brewing Co. announced Monday that they have begun selling their well-known --in Alaska, anyway -- brand in Minnesota. To commemorate the event, Alaskan Brewing employees, including founders Marcy and Geoff Larson, have descended on the Land of 10,000 Lakes for a blitz of brew tastings and debuts around the Twin Cities area of Minneapolis and St. Paul. The events begin Monday and carry all the way through to Minnesota Craft Beer Week, which starts May 12.
